R300m for 8 weeks’ work? South African golfers LIVE IT UP on a new golf tour backed by Saudi Arabia

The first LIV Golf season left South Africans laughing all the way to the bank, with Branden Grace being the highest earner with over R300 million placed into his fast expanding bank account.

Grace, who won the Portland LIV Golf event, earned a staggering R304 028 130 from the six events he participated in; however, due to injury, he had to withdraw from the Bangkok event. Grace was second in overall season earnings, with American Dustin Johnson leading the statistics with a staggering R651 345 661.

Charl Schwartzel was second with R149 367 548, and Louis Oosthuizen was third with R99 060 200.

The season earnings of 26-year-old Hennie du Plessis will likely be the most life-altering. With only two victories on the Sunshine Tour to his credit, Du Plessis made a staggering R83,175,783 with LIV Golf.

The 2020-21 Sunshine Tour Order of Merit winner Christiaan Bezuidenhout earned R7.7 million in South Africa last year. Last place in one LIV Golf event (yes, just one) would have been sufficient for fifth place on the Order of Merit for the whole season.

The career earnings of Oosthuizen, Grace, and Schwartzel on the other tours also make for intriguing reading. Schwartzel has earned $20,912,493 or R308 million on the US PGA Tour and €17,661,955 or R288 million on the DP World Tour. Oosthuizen has won $28 124 759 (R432m) on the PGA Tour and €19 334 034 (R312m) on the DP World Tour. Grace has earned $12,222,147 (R188 million) on the PGA Tour and €14,152,358 (R233 million) on the DP World Tour.

The Saudi regime’s human rights violations are heinous, and the country’s monarchy’s role in LIV via supporting the series through its Public Investment Fund has been widely criticised.

Events such as the LIV Golf series are blatant examples of “sports washing.” However, it is evident that the best players will always tee off if the money is appropriate.
